    I was reading abt preprocessor directives and discovered these little macros to output line # s and file names, useful when you're trying to find out where the thing is crashing and/or debug. __LINE__ , __FILE__, __DATE__ . so easy! 2/2

    C++ useful debugging tools, valgrind for finding memory leaks and other errors. valgrind --leak-check=yes ./prog-name args > out.log 2>&1 will send the output to a file -- there's a lot, you want this. ( apt install valgrind ) 1/
